Talking About Glaucoma Podcast
Jun 9th, 2021
The Talking About Glaucoma podcast has been around since 2009. In each episode, Dr Robert Schertzer, a Vancouver-based glaucoma specialist, talks with a different glaucoma colleague about a hot topic in glaucoma. Evidence-Informed Approaches to Teleglaucoma in Canada
Apr 14th, 2021
April 2021 EXECUTIVE SUMMARY This report provides a review of evidence-informed approaches to teleglaucoma (TG) care in Canadian contexts as of January 2021. TG is defined as a spectrum of options that adapts telemedicine approaches to enhance care for glaucoma patients (those diagnosed with as well as at risk for developing glaucoma).
